Output abd0031f2702fa04751621f5431a1185405e09031d2d471f169c66abbab07c24:7

value
31695489
script pubkey
OP_0 OP_PUSHBYTES_32 317f04f0ed998119239ecfe0b1c6966e6278e652a293ec266048ded9ea99ad1c
address
bc1qx9lsfu8dnxq3jgu7elstr35kde383ejj52f7cfnqfr0dn65e45wqrjs9d5
transaction
abd0031f2702fa04751621f5431a1185405e09031d2d471f169c66abbab07c24
spent
true